AB The effect of the prolong oscillation of water temperature on content of the energy substances and ATP-ase activity in the gill of the freshwater bivalve mollusk Unio tumidus has been studied. The decrease of glycogen and total protein content along with differently directed changes of total lipids content and intensity of lipid peroxidation were noted. Dependence was stated between ATP-ase activity in the gills of U. tumidus on oscillation of water temperature.
